Summary of the German Driving License

In Germany, the driving license is categorized into various classes based upon car types. It is necessary to determine which class applies to you based upon the automobiles you mean to run.

The Process: Step by Step

Navigating through the actions of getting a German driving license can be streamlined into numerous phases.

1. Select an Accredited Driving School

The primary step is picking a driving school that is certified and acknowledged in Germany. This is vital as they will assist you through the process, from lessons to documents.

2. Theoretical Training

You will go through theoretical training, generally making up 14 or 16 educational units, depending upon the class of license. Subjects covered consist of traffic guidelines, roadway indications, and vehicle technology.

3. Practical Training

After completing the theoretical part, you will begin practical driving lessons.  expressdeutschekartes  of lessons needed can differ based on individual competence but averages around 12-- 20 hours.

4. Taking the Exam

Once both theory and useful training are finished, candidates will sit for evaluations.

  • Theoretical Exam: An online test consisting of multiple-choice questions will examine your knowledge.
  • Practical Exam: A certified examiner will assess your driving skills in real road conditions.

5. Get Your License

Upon successful conclusion of both tests, you will receive your German driving license. If you are a foreigner converting your license, additional actions might be required, such as documentation verification.

Frequently asked questions About Obtaining a German Driving License

Q1: Can I drive in Germany with a foreign driving license?A1: Yes, if your foreign license stands and written in German or accompanied by an official translation, you can drive for up to 6 months. After this duration, you will need to make an application for a German license. Q2: Are there any exemptions for foreign residents?A2: Yes, citizens

from EU nations or countries with reciprocity arrangements may have the ability to exchange their existing driving licenses for a German one without extra screening. Q3: How long does it require to get a German driving license?A3: The timeframe varies based upon individual learning speed, but generally, it might take a couple of months to complete both the theoretical and practical training and pass the examinations. Q4: What files are required to use for a driving license?A4: Required files usually include a legitimate ID or passport, evidence of residency, eye test results, medical certificate, and passport-sized photos. Q5: Is driving school expensive?A5: The cost can differ substantially but anticipate to pay
between EUR1,500 and EUR2,500 for detailed training, including both theoretical and practical lessons. Getting a German driving license is a precise process
